Brown, Merle Elliott

Merle J. Brown, 91, a resident of the Holiday Resort care center since 1995. died Nov. 21, 2001, at the care center. Mrs. Brown was a homemaker. She was a longtime resident of Ottawa and also a resident of McPherson for 15 years.

Merle J. Totten, the daughter of Myrt J. and Mamie F Clark Totten, was born Aug 13, 1910, at Ottawa. She graduated from Ottawa High School, and from Ottawa Business College.

She married Cecil Leslie Elliott, on July 29, at Ottawa. He died Aug 2, 1970. She married the Rev Olin B. Brown on Nov 29, 1975 at Ottawa. He died Jan 8, 1988. Mrs Brown was a member of the Free Methodist Church in Ottawa.

She is survived by four grandchildren, Rory Elliott, Ricky Elliott and April Barley all of Seattle Washington. and Marci Elliott of Las Vegas, Nev.; and two great-grandchildren. Survivors in this area include her niece, Jeanne Hatcher of Strong City, who was her caretaker for several years. Other survivors include one niece, Mary Lou Branstrator of Toledo, Iowa, two nephews Calvin Faulkner of Baltimore, Md and Charles Faulkner of Carmel, Ind.

A son, Marvin Elliott, and two sisters, Viola Johnson and Lenita Faulkner died earlier. The private memorial service will be held at a later date. Memorial contributions to the Holiday Resort or the Free Methodist Church can be sent to the Dengel and Son Morturary, 234 S Hickory, Ottawa, Ks 66067

Chase County Leader-News, Cottonwood Falls, Kansas, Nov, 2001
